Subject: [PATCH v1 4/5] spi: pxa2xx: Convert to use device_get_match_data()
Date: Fri, 18 Oct 2019 13:54:28 +0300	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20191018105429.82782-4-andriy.shevchenko@linux.intel.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20191018105429.82782-1-andriy.shevchenko@linux.intel.com>

Convert to use device_get_match_data() instead of open coded variant.

While here, switch of_property_read_bool() to device_property_read_bool().

 drivers/spi/spi-pxa2xx.c | 26 +++++++-------------------
 1 file changed, 7 insertions(+), 19 deletions(-)

diff --git a/drivers/spi/spi-pxa2xx.c b/drivers/spi/spi-pxa2xx.c
index 04ca80770e35..684a5585ac7f 100644
--- a/drivers/spi/spi-pxa2xx.c
+++ b/drivers/spi/spi-pxa2xx.c
@@ -22,6 +22,7 @@
 #include <linux/pci.h>
 #include <linux/platform_device.h>
 #include <linux/pm_runtime.h>
+#include <linux/property.h>
 #include <linux/slab.h>
 #include <linux/spi/pxa2xx_spi.h>
 #include <linux/spi/spi.h>
@@ -1512,34 +1513,21 @@ static struct pxa2xx_spi_controller *
 pxa2xx_spi_init_pdata(struct platform_device *pdev)
 {
 	struct pxa2xx_spi_controller *pdata;
-	struct acpi_device *adev;
 	struct ssp_device *ssp;
 	struct resource *res;
-	const struct acpi_device_id *adev_id = NULL;
 	const struct pci_device_id *pcidev_id = NULL;
-	const struct of_device_id *of_id = NULL;
 	enum pxa_ssp_type type;
+	const void *match;
 
-	adev = ACPI_COMPANION(&pdev->dev);
-
-	if (pdev->dev.of_node)
-		of_id = of_match_device(pdev->dev.driver->of_match_table,
-					&pdev->dev);
-	else if (dev_is_pci(pdev->dev.parent))
+	if (dev_is_pci(pdev->dev.parent))
 		pcidev_id = pci_match_id(pxa2xx_spi_pci_compound_match,
 					 to_pci_dev(pdev->dev.parent));
-	else if (adev)
-		adev_id = acpi_match_device(pdev->dev.driver->acpi_match_table,
-					    &pdev->dev);
-	else
-		return NULL;
 
-	if (adev_id)
-		type = (enum pxa_ssp_type)adev_id->driver_data;
+	match = device_get_match_data(&pdev->dev);
+	if (match)
+		type = (enum pxa_ssp_type)match;
 	else if (pcidev_id)
 		type = (enum pxa_ssp_type)pcidev_id->driver_data;
-	else if (of_id)
-		type = (enum pxa_ssp_type)of_id->data;
 	else
 		return NULL;
 
@@ -1572,7 +1560,7 @@ pxa2xx_spi_init_pdata(struct platform_device *pdev)
 	ssp->dev = &pdev->dev;
 	ssp->port_id = pxa2xx_spi_get_port_id(&pdev->dev);
 
-	pdata->is_slave = of_property_read_bool(pdev->dev.of_node, "spi-slave");
+	pdata->is_slave = device_property_read_bool(&pdev->dev, "spi-slave");
 	pdata->num_chipselect = 1;
 	pdata->enable_dma = true;
 	pdata->dma_burst_size = 1;
